Final Answer :
Choice of methods of recording fair value adjustments:
- Fair value adjustments can be made in the records of the subsidiary or as consolidation adjustments.
- If the group uses the revaluation model for property,plant and equipment and intangible assets,the fair value adjustments will be made in subsidiary accounts.If the cost model is used,the adjustments will be made on consolidation.
